Black Water Extraction (Category 3) Cost in Goulds, FL

The cost of Black Water Extraction (Category 3) can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Goulds, FL. Here’s a rough estimate of what you might expect to pay: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Assessment and Pre-Treatment $500 – $2,000 The size of the affected area and the extent of the damage.
Water Extraction and Drying $2,000 – $10,000 The size of the affected area and the amount of water to be extracted.
Cleaning and Sanitizing $1,000 – $5,000 The size of the affected area and the level of contamination.
Drying and Moisture Control $1,500 – $7,500 The size of the affected area and the humidity levels.

Common Questions About Black Water Extraction (Category 3)

How Long Does Black Water Extraction (Category 3) Take?

Our team will work to complete the process within 3-5 days. This timeline can vary dep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. We’ll keep you updated every step of the way.

Is Black Water Extraction (Category 3) Covered by Insurance?

It depends on your insurance policy. We recommend reviewing your policy to understand what’s covered and what’s not. We can help you navigate the process.

Can Black Water Extraction (Category 3) Cause Health Risks?

Yes, if not addressed properly. Standing water can lead to mold growth, which can exacerbate allergies and respiratory issues. Our team uses EPA-registered cleaning agents to ensure your home is safe and healthy.
